RELAND, HADRIAN.

De Spoliis Templi Hierosolymitani in Arcu Titiano [“Of the Spoils of the Jerusalem Temple in the Arch of Titus.”]

FIRST EDITION. Latin interspersed with Greek and Hebrew. Several foldout engravings of Temple vessels and appurtenances. Extensive Latin marginalia in an old hand pp. (4), 138, (26). Contemporary vellum. 12mo

Utrecht: William Broedelet 1716

Est: $400 - $600
Dutch Orientalist Hadrian Reland (1676-1718) was Professor of Oriental Languages and Antiquities at Utrecht. Reland drew upon a vast array of classical authors, Talmudic literature and church historians, which he quotes in the original. See EJ, Vol. XIV, col. 64.
